A Conceptual Art project celebrating the 100th year anniversary of the publication of “Towards a New Architecture” by the Swiss architect Le Corbusier. As a free-flowing artistic homage to Dadaist and Surrealist traditions, it follows the same morphological rules of the “Cancellature” of Emilio Isgrò, the “Greguerías” of Ramon Gomez de la Serna, and the censorship redactions produced by contemporary intelligence agencies. This publication identifies transformational intentions and imaginative variations to redact and transform, by means of deliberate erasures, the original version of Le Corbusier’s book. The final result is a collection of unique messages for the advancement of today’s architecture and urbanism.
